Singing Teacher
Singing Teacher
Ken is bel canto specialist tenor and a doctoral research scholar in Historical Performance Practice at the Royal College of Music London. He has 15 years teaching experience and has students in operas and conservatoires around the world. He regularly presents his academic research at conferences and based on his research he is expected to publish a bel canto singing treatise after his doctorate.
Master Singing Teacher
Master Singing Teacher
American tenor Bruce Ford is acknowledged internationally as one of the finest singers of his generation. His exceptionally demanding repertoire is highlighted by many of the most challenging Mozart and bel canto roles, which have brought him consistent acclaim throughout North America and Europe. Numerous major opera houses have revived unjustly neglected works especially for him.
Repertoire & Vocal Coach
Repertoire & Vocal Coach
Although trained in England she has spent most of her working life as a répétiteur in Italy; At the Teatro Verdi in Trieste, the Teatro Massimo in Palermo, and the Teatro Piccolo (Strehler) in Milano, touring China, France, Germany, Italy, Japan Russia and Spain.
For six years she was Maestro di Sala and Maestro al cembalo/fortepiano at the Rossini Opera festival in Pesaro.

Conductor
Conductor
David Parry is acknowledged as an inspirational champion of operatic, concert and symphonic repertoire across a vast range. He has been responsible for the re-appraisal of countless lesser-known compositions in a series of multi-award-winning productions and recordings, featuring some of the world’s finest singers.

Gerhard Gall
Gerhard Gall
German Language Coach
German Language Coach
As a German language coach, Gerhard he has worked with singers of the Royal Opera House, Glyndebourne Festival Opera, the Bayreuther Festspiele, the Royal College of Music, the Royal Academy of Music, Guildhall School of Music and Drama, Cardiff/Welsh International Academy of Voice, and the National Opera Studio, London.
